Key Responsibilities:
  • Design and implement automation systems of varying complexity.
  • Oversee all automation aspects for designated projects.
  • Customize programming and configuration for a range of products, including specialized equipment.
  • Develop and validate new feature requirements for next-generation solutions.
  • Address complex automation design challenges through programming, sequencing, and electrical signaling.
  • Troubleshoot and test advanced PLC programming and motion control systems.
  • Provide mentorship on standards and best practices to junior engineers and technicians.
  • Apply existing technologies creatively to new applications.
Qualifications:
  • Local candidates preferred.
  • Onsite work is required, with occasional weekend commitments.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in automation engineering.
  • Proficient in Delta V, Foxboro, Wonderware, Rockwell, RSLogix5000, FactoryTalk View, and related platforms.
  • Experience with Siemens Simatic APT is advantageous; training available for candidates with Rockwell PLC knowledge.
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ering or a related scientific field is required.
  • Experience with Emerson Syncade and Delta V software is beneficial.
  • Familiarity with FDA regulations and validation processes is essential.
  • Understanding of 21 CFR Part 11 and GAMP 5 guidelines.
  • Experience in recipe configuration and integration testing.
  • Strong troubleshooting skills in manufacturing environments.
  • Technical expertise in automated manufacturing, assembly, and packaging systems.
  • Ability to make independent decisions and manage priorities effectively.
  • Strong interpersonal skills for effective communication and collaboration.
  • Experience in adapting to high levels of challenge and change.
